10 Good Resolutions for the New Year: How to Keep and Achieve Them

Every year we set resolutions for the New Year, but often we fail in accomplishing them. However, there are some simple steps we can take to increase our chances of success. In this article, we will cover 10 good resolutions for the New Year and how to keep and achieve them.

1. Start with a plan

The first step towards keeping resolutions is to have a clear plan. Make sure that the resolutions you set are feasible and specific. For example, instead of setting a resolution like ‘I want to be more fit’, set a specific goal like ‘I want to lose 10 pounds by the end of March through a regular workout schedule and healthy eating habits’. Plan ahead and create actionable steps that you can easily follow.

2. Practice mindfulness and meditation

Practicing mindfulness and meditation can help you stay focused and centered throughout the year. It will help you manage stress better and improve your overall well-being. Take out some time every day to meditate and reflect on your goals.

3. Incorporate more physical activity

Exercise not only helps with physical fitness but also with mental health. Set a realistic goal for yourself like 30 minutes of exercise every day or a certain number of steps daily. Join a gym or try new physical activities like taking up dancing or joining a sports team.

4. Achieve a work-life balance

Achieving a work-life balance is crucial to maintaining our well-being. Make sure to take time for yourself and your loved ones throughout the busy year. Schedule in time for relaxation, hobbies, and other activities that make you happy.

5. Focus on self-care

Self-care is vital to our physical and mental health. Take time to pamper yourself, tend to your mental health, and prioritize sleep. Practice healthy self-talk, reward yourself for accomplishments, and practice gratitude.

6. Learn something new

Learning new things not only improves our skills but also keeps our brains sharp. Challenge yourself by learning a new skill like cooking, learning a new language, or picking up a new hobby.

7. Cut back on screen time

In today’s digital age, we are constantly plugged into technology. This can lead to a variety of health problems, both mentally and physically. Set a time limit for your screen time, try digital detox, and engage in activities that do not involve screens.

8. Improve your eating habits

Eating a balanced and healthy diet is essential for our well-being. Set achievable goals like adding more fruits and vegetables to your daily diet or cutting back on processed foods. Learn to cook healthy meals and try new recipes.

9. Read more books

Reading is an excellent way to relax and expand our knowledge. Set a goal to read a certain number of books each month or read books on new topics that you find interesting.

10. Practice giving back

Giving back to the community is an excellent way to spread kindness, connect with others, and give back to society. Devote some time or resources to a charitable organization or volunteer in your local community.

In conclusion, setting resolutions for the New Year is an excellent way to improve our lives, but what’s crucial is keeping and achieving them. Use these tips to make progress towards your goals, celebrate small wins, and don’t be too hard on yourself if you slip up. Remember, the most significant progress comes from incremental changes, and with time and dedication, you can achieve your goals.
